4. What Are Phuthi's Greatest Deeds?
Phuthi’s achievements as a change-maker are endless! Her business accomplishments alone are legendary.
At age 17, she departs Johannesburg, South Africa, to attend Douglass College at Rutgers University in the United States. She graduates with a bachelor’s degree in Economics in 1993. In 1996, she earns an MBA from De Montfort University. In 2008, she completes Harvard University’s Kennedy School of Government executive education program, “Global Leadership and Public Policy for the 21st Century.”
Steering billion-dollar companies like Shanduka Group and Naspers to phenomenal success, she empowers African innovation to thrive globally.
But her real superpowers are in uplifting others. She also mentors young leaders and promotes STEM education for girls. And motivating policies to support small business growth in South Africa.
Phuthi engages in various youth-related activities in her personal capacity. She mentors young professionals and provides support to students. Additionally, she participates in the “Dignity Day” program, led by Young Global Leaders of the World Economic Forum, aiming to instill the values of dignity in young individuals. She holds an honorary membership with the Golden Key International Honour Society and serves as a Patron of the Bosele Foundation.
Phuthi’s vision is an Africa where all people, regardless of gender or background, can prosper. She’s the first Black woman to lead major multinationals in Africa.
And she motivates young minds as a role model who tend to achieve immense success without compromising their identity or values. Phuthi shows you can uplift your community on the climb to the top.
Additionally, she serves on the board of the Cyril Ramaphosa Foundation, which prioritizes education and entrepreneurship initiatives. The foundation’s Adopt-A-School program has positively impacted 713,434 learners, while its Black Umbrellas initiative successfully incubates 2,775 Black businesses, turning them into employers in various industries. Through her involvement, Phuthi contributes significantly to empowering the youth and fostering economic growth and development in the community.

5. What Has Phuthi Faced as Challenges?
Like any superhero, Phuthi faces some ruthless villains!
Growing up as a young Black girl in apartheid South Africa, the odds are stacked against her from the start. But with the spirit of Harriet Tubman, Phuthi perseveres through it all.
As a female business leader, she battles discrimination in male-dominated industries. But Phuthi keeps smashing those glass ceilings like Rosa Parks stood up to racism!
Launching new ventures in emerging markets comes with massive challenges. But she meets each one with the courage of Serena Williams and the grit of Folorunso Alakija!
Phuthi starts her educational journey in Maseru, attending primary school. After returning to Johannesburg, she completes her schooling at McAuley House Convent in Milpark. Upon arriving at McAuley House, she struggles with English fluency and feels like an outsider in her school friends’ unfamiliar world.
Despite the cultural differences, her school friends kindly invite her to birthday parties at venues that didn’t accept Black people. They make special arrangements to ensure she attends. Nevertheless, every day when she goes back home to Soweto, the striking contrast between her life and that of her school friends remains apparent.
Phuthi faces one of her biggest challenges at the age of 17 when she loses her mother during her matric. Shortly after, she starts her university life in the States, living alone in a country she’d never been to before. Despite the initial challenge, she works very hard and draws inspiration from her parents, always focusing on seeking opportunities rather than dwelling on obstacles.
No matter the villains or trials she faces, this icon remains unstoppable! Phuthi shows women everywhere the power of perseverance. She gives you the strength to conquer your own challenges.
In the corporate world, she faces discrimination as a Black woman but still has the determination to lead in the boardroom.
Phuthi receives criticism for trying to “do it all” – run companies while supporting charities and community programs. There were times she almost lost hope.
But Phuthi works tirelessly to honor her parent’s sacrifice and make them proud.
Phuthi shows that difficulties either deflate you or fuel your fire for justice. She took life’s hardest battles and stands out even stronger in her mission to empower.
